Sujata Chaudhuri Explained
Sujata Chaudhuri (born 23 March 1901) was an Indian professor of medicine and first physician at Lady Hardinge Medical College, New Delhi, India. On 1 December 1966, she was appointed emeritus scientist.[1] [2] [3] [4]
